Burnout in emergency department staff: The prevalence and barriers to intervention
Reshen Naidoo1, Renata Schoeman1
1Faculty of Economics and Management Sciences, Stellenbosch Business School, Cape Town, South Africa.
Background:
Burnout impacts patient care and staff well-being. Emergency department (ED) staff are at an elevated risk for burnout. Despite an acceleration in burnout research due to the coronavirus disease 2019 (COVID-19) pandemic, there is limited data on the nature and prevalence of burnout in the South African emergency medicine setting.
Aim:
This study determined the prevalence of burnout in ED staff (doctors, nurses and non-clinical staff) at Tygerberg Hospital and explored staff awareness and utilisation of interventions.
Setting:
The study was conducted at Tygerberg Hospital, South Africa.
Methods:
This cross-sectional study used the Maslach Burnout Inventory to assess burnout via a self-administered electronic survey in a convenience sample of 109 ED staff. Quantitative data were analysed with descriptive and inferential statistics. Qualitative data were analysed using thematic analysis.
Results:
A total of 46 participants (45.10%) experienced burnout, with 73 participants (71.57%) at high risk for emotional exhaustion or depersonalisation. The prevalence of burnout in doctors was 57.89%, non-clinical staff was 25.93%, and nursing staff was 50.00%. Burnout was higher in doctors and nursing staff compared to non-clinical staff, with high emotional exhaustion and depersonalisation found in interns and specialist professional nurses. The level of intervention awareness was 41.8% and the level of intervention utilisation was 8.82%. Thematic analysis identified awareness, accessibility and reactive utilisation as barriers to utilisation with opportunities to reduce burnout and enhance resilience.
Conclusion:
Coordinated health system and organisational efforts are required to optimise intervention strategies to reduce burnout.
Contribution:
Guidance on the design and planning of intervention strategies considering at risk groups, intervention-related factors, and non-clinical staff.

Barriers to Effective Communication II
Cultural barriers:
Differences in values, beliefs, religion, knowledge, and tradition can significantly impact communication. Awareness of nonverbal cues is critical, especially when conversing with a patient from a different culture. What appears appropriate in one culture may be inappropriate in another.
